Dorman 34-1421 Rear Leaf Spring Assembly
Dorman 34-1421 is a rear leaf spring assembly for select Dodge Dakota models. It is built from steel with a standard suspension grade design, 5 leaves, and a 1200 load rate to help restore rear suspension support on the vehicle.
Key Features
- Steel leaf spring construction
- Rear axle orientation for select Dodge Dakota applications
- 5-leaf design with 2.5 in. leaf width
- 1200 load rate
- Black bushings included
- Standard replacement suspension grade
- End 1: Berlin eye; End 2: up turned eye
- Pack thickness: 1.411 in.; leaf spring arch length: 7 in.

Installation Notes and Tips
Verify the vehicle year, model, rear position, and listed notes before ordering. This part is specified for 1999-2004 Dodge Dakota rear use, with 5 leaf construction and 1.4375 in. pack thickness noted in fitment data. Confirm the spring eye style, arch length, and width against the original component to ensure proper alignment during installation.
